
Quan Capital
Description
Quan Capital is a prominent healthcare-focused venture capital firm, established in 2010, with a distinctive dual presence in Shanghai, China, and Palo Alto, California. This strategic positioning allows the firm to bridge the significant healthcare innovation ecosystems of both the United States and China, identifying and nurturing groundbreaking companies in the life sciences sector. Their investment mandate spans a broad spectrum of healthcare sub-sectors, including biopharmaceuticals, medical devices, diagnostics, and digital health, reflecting a comprehensive approach to addressing global health challenges.
The firm employs a flexible investment strategy, engaging with companies across various development stages, from early-stage startups to more mature, late-stage enterprises. Quan Capital typically seeks to lead or co-lead investment rounds, providing not only capital but also strategic guidance and operational support to its portfolio companies. Initial investments generally range from $10 million to $30 million, demonstrating their capacity to make substantial commitments to promising ventures. Their investment philosophy emphasizes long-term partnerships and a deep understanding of the scientific and commercial intricacies of the healthcare industry.
Over its operational history, Quan Capital has successfully raised and deployed significant capital across multiple funds. The firm closed its first fund, Quan Capital I, in 2010, followed by Quan Capital II in 2014, and Quan Capital III in 2019. Most recently, in March 2024, Quan Capital announced the final close of its fourth fund, Quan Capital IV, bringing its total assets under management to over $1.2 billion across these four dedicated healthcare funds. This consistent growth in fund size underscores investor confidence in their expertise and investment track record.

Investor Profile
Quan Capital has backed more than 24 startups, with 2 new investments in the last 12 months alone. The firm has led 5 rounds, about 21% of its total and boasts 7 exits across its portfolio.
Investment Focus Highlights
- Concentrates on Series A, Series B, Series C rounds (top funding stages).
- Majority of deals are located in United States, China, United Kingdom.
- Strong thematic focus on Biotechnology, Health Care, Pharmaceutical.
- Typical check size: $10M – $30M.
Stage Focus
- Series A (42%)
- Series B (38%)
- Series C (13%)
- Series D (4%)
- Series Unknown (4%)
Country Focus
- United States (71%)
- China (13%)
- United Kingdom (8%)
- Hong Kong (4%)
- Switzerland (4%)
